The Impact Of Mindfulness Practice On Emotional Exhaustion Of Sales Personnel

Emotional exhaustion could cause lots of negative consequences on employers,such as lower self-esteem and job satisfaction,less work engagement,worse work performance and higher turnover intention.Since its severe undesirable impacts on individuals’ mental health and work life,a great number of studies have been conducted to explore how to alleviate the negative effects of emotional exhaustion.One of them is focusing on the mindfulness training.Mindfulness training is a series of activities through which one can improve his or her mindfulness.Research has demonstrated that mindfulness training can effective increase employers’ levels of mindfulness and decrease emotional exhaustion.Considering the cultural differences between Chinese and the Western countries,however,whether this result would be true in China need to be further explored by more studies.On the other hand,salesmen are at high risk of emotional exhaustion.They work under great intensity and high stress,and their work are always interacting with different kinds of people which make them have to do more emotional labor.All this makes them be more likely to engage in emotional exhaustion.Thus,it is very necessary to explore studies that aimed at reducing salesmen emotional exhaustion.The present research conducted two studies among Chinese employers.Study one analyzed the association between levels of mindfulness and emotional exhaustion through survey design.Study two tested the association between mindfulness training and emotional exhaustion with the pretest/post-test control group experimental design.The present study was expected to provide empirical evidence for the link between mindfulness training and salesmen emotional exhaustion,and offer practical guidance for the intervention and treatment of emotional exhaustion.A sample of 251 salesmen participate in study one.They completed the Mindful Attention Awareness Scale and the Emotional Exhaustion Scale of the Maslach Burnout Inventory-General Survey.The correlational analysis was conducted to uncover the association between the levels of mindfulness and emotional exhaustion.Then sixty salespeople were selected to participate in study two.They were divided into three groups:mindfulness training group,exercise training group and non-training group.The mindfulness training group completed an 8-week Mindfulness-Based Cognitive Therapy Program according to the guidance of the Mindful Way Workbook.The exercise training group completed 8-week exercise.The non-training group do not participate in any training.Before and after the 8-week training,the mindfulness and exhaustion scores of the three groups were measured by the Mindful Attention Awareness Scale and the Emotional Exhaustion Scale of the Maslach Burnout Inventory-General Survey.The data were analyzed the T test.The results showed that:(1)the levels of mindfulness was significantly and negatively associated with salesmen emotional exhaustion(2)for the mindfulness training group,the mindfulness scores of pretest were significantly lower than that of post-test;(3)for the mindfulness training group,the emotional exhaustion scores of pretest were significantly higher than that of post-test;(4)there are significant differences in the scores of mindfulness between mindfulness training group and non-training group,and the mindfulness scores of mindfulness training group were significantly higher than that of non-training group;(5)there are significant differences in the scores of emotional exhaustion between mindfulness training group and non-training group,and the emotional exhaustion scores of mindfulness training group were significantly lower than that of non-training group;(6)there are significant differences in the scores of mindfulness between mindfulness training group and exercise training group,and the mindfulness scores of mindfulness training group were significantly higher than that of exercise training group;(7)there are significant differences in the scores of emotional exhaustion between mindfulness training group and exercise self-training group,the emotional exhaustion scores of mindfulness self-training group were significantly lower than that of exercise self-training group.The above results indicate that salesmen’s mindfulness was strongly correlated with exhaustion,and mindfulness self-training can effectively improve mindfulness and decrease emotional exhaustion among salesmen.The limitations and implications of this study as well as the future research directions are discussed.
